admin 管理员组文章数量: 1184232
此项目大体上也就是用java中的jdbc和GUI编程相结合,我实现的功能是运行代码进入到登录界面然后输入用户名和密码存到数据库中最后跳转到写字板界面,下面直接贴上这几天所做的项目源码。
登录界面和连接数据库。
package demo;import javax.swing.*;import com.mysql.jdbc.PreparedStatement;import java.awt.*;import java.awt.event.ActionEvent;import java.awt.event.ActionListener;import java.io.IOException;import java.io.InputStream;import java.sql.Connection;import java.sql.DriverManager;import java.sql.SQLException;import java.util.Properties;publicclassLogextendsJFrameimplementsActionListener{
public JLabel j1;public JLabel j2;public JLabel j3;public JTextField jt1;public JTextField jt2;public JButton jb1;public JButton jb2;//从已创建好的jFrame窗口中取出一个内容面板
Container cp=this.getContentPane();publicLog(){
super("写字板登录界面");
j1=newJLabel("用户名");
jt1=newJTextField(10);
j2=newJLabel("密码");
jt2=newJTextField(10);
jb1=newJButton("登录");
jb2=newJButton("取消");
j3=newJLabel("");
cp.add(j1);
cp.add(jt1);
cp.add(j2);
cp.add(jt2);
cp.add(jb1);
cp.add(jb2);
cp.add(j3);
cp.setLayout(newFlowLayout());// 采用流式布局
jb1.addActionListener(this);//添加监听器
jb2.addActionListener(newActionListener(){
publicvoidactionPerformed(ActionEvent e){
jt1.setText(""版权声明:本文标题:从理论到实践:Java JDBC与GUI协同创建强大登录模块 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/b/1771889290a3549716.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论